探索 Stratio’s Cassandra Lucene Index:高效的全文搜索与分析工具

探索 Stratio’s Cassandra Lucene Index:高效的全文搜索与分析工具

cassandra-lucene-indexLucene based secondary indexes for Cassandra项目地址:https://gitcode.com/gh_mirrors/ca/cassandra-lucene-index

在当今大数据时代,高效的数据检索和分析能力是企业竞争力的关键。Stratio’s Cassandra Lucene Index 是一个强大的开源插件,它将 Apache Cassandra 的存储能力与 Apache Lucene 的搜索功能完美结合,为用户提供了一个既强大又灵活的数据处理平台。

项目介绍

Stratio’s Cassandra Lucene Index 是一个专为 Apache Cassandra 设计的插件,它通过集成 Apache Lucene 的强大搜索功能,扩展了 Cassandra 的索引能力。这个插件支持全文搜索、多变量搜索、地理空间搜索以及双时间搜索等多种高级搜索功能,使得 Cassandra 不仅适用于实时数据处理,也适用于复杂的数据分析任务。

项目技术分析

Stratio’s Cassandra Lucene Index 的核心技术在于其能够将 Lucene 的索引机制无缝集成到 Cassandra 的分布式架构中。每个集群节点都能独立地索引其数据,这不仅提高了搜索的效率,也增强了系统的可扩展性和容错性。此外,该插件还支持复杂的查询优化,如通过 Lucene 过滤器减少 MapReduce 框架(如 Apache Hadoop 和 Apache Spark)处理的数据量,从而显著提升数据分析的性能。

项目及技术应用场景

Stratio’s Cassandra Lucene Index 适用于多种场景,特别是在需要快速、灵活搜索和分析大量数据的场合。例如:

  • 社交媒体分析:快速检索和分析用户生成的内容,如推文、评论等。
  • 电子商务:实现商品的快速搜索和个性化推荐。
  • 地理信息系统:处理和分析地理空间数据,如地图服务、位置跟踪等。
  • 金融交易分析:实时分析交易数据,进行风险评估和市场预测。

项目特点

Stratio’s Cassandra Lucene Index 的主要特点包括:

  • 全文搜索:支持语言感知分析、通配符、模糊和正则表达式搜索。
  • 布尔搜索:支持 AND、OR、NOT 等逻辑操作。
  • 排序功能:可以根据相关性、列值和距离进行排序。
  • 地理空间索引:支持点、线、多边形及其组合的地理空间索引和操作。
  • 双时间搜索:支持有效时间和交易时间的搜索。
  • 兼容性:与第三方 CQL 驱动、Spark 和 Hadoop 兼容。

Stratio’s Cassandra Lucene Index 是一个功能丰富、性能卓越的工具,它不仅增强了 Cassandra 的搜索能力,也为大数据分析提供了新的可能性。无论是实时数据处理还是复杂的数据分析,Stratio’s Cassandra Lucene Index 都能提供强大的支持。

cassandra-lucene-indexLucene based secondary indexes for Cassandra项目地址:https://gitcode.com/gh_mirrors/ca/cassandra-lucene-index

  • 2
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

张萌纳

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值